What to Use if You Don’t Have Shaoxing Wine: The Best Substitutes

Most ‘Chinese cooking wines’ sold outside of Asia aren’t Shaoxing wine at all; they’re often heavily salted, generic substitutes that can throw off an entire dish. If you find yourself without the real deal, the most effective and widely available substitute that genuinely captures Shaoxing’s distinctive savory, nutty, and slightly sweet depth is dry sherry, […]
